World War fiction is a genre that has been around for centuries, and for good reason. The stories of war are often heartbreaking and tragic, but they can also be incredibly gripping and inspiring. The best World War fiction novels tell the stories of ordinary people who are caught up in extraordinary circumstances, and they offer a unique perspective on the human experience.

If you're looking for a good World War fiction novel to read, here are a few of our favorites:

  • All Quiet on the Western Front by Erich Maria Remarque: This classic novel tells the story of a young German soldier who experiences the horrors of World War I firsthand. It is a powerful and moving indictment of war, and it remains one of the most important works of literature ever written.
